Every year Nepal legalizes marijuana nationwide for just one day.

To Nepalese Hindus, cannabis isn’t just a plant—it’s sacred. During Shiva Ratri, over a million devotees gather to honor Shiva, the god of creation, by lighting up at Kathmandu’s holiest temple.
